Mission Statement:

Our mission is to be a home to entrepreneurs. We strive to provide a support system for our clients so they can successfully grow their business through market penetration, job creation, and capital accumulation.

Primary Programs:

Training – A variety of workshops and courses designed to meet the needs of entrepreneurs starting and growing businesses; topics include accounting, marketing, business planning, internet marketing, search engine optimization, social media, etc.

Consulting – One-on-one sessions conducted by WESST staff and a network of affiliates and community volunteers tailored to the specific needs of clients;

Loans – A revolving loan fund offering low-interest loans to New Mexican entrepreneurs. Special Programs - including and Youth Individual Development Account program which provides financial literacy training and a matched savings program to low-income individuals; and a Refugee Microenterprise Program targeted to political refugees residing in New Mexico.

Business incubation – The WESST Enterprise Center is a mixed-use business incubator in downtown Albuquerque offering state-of-the-art amenities and business assistance to 20 manufacturing, service, and technology businesses. WESST customizes support to accelerate growth and encourage long-term success. The facility is currently 100% occupied.
